      Meaning of the first name Loverna

      Origin

      Latin, possibly Italian.

      Meaning

      Loverna means "beloved" or "one who is loved."

      Variations

      Laverna, Allovera, Laverne

      Based on our records...

      Hall

      This is the most common surname associated with Loverna.

      James

      This is the most common name of those married to a Loverna.

      Evelyn

      This is the most common name for a child of a Loverna.

      Did you know?

      1872 is when there were the most people born with the first name Loverna.
